LaSalle County has many natural resources; rivers, canyons, prairie and forests combine with history to delight your senses. Experience Starved Rock State Park that was first explored by Joliet & Father Marquette in the 17th century to the sight of Cascade Falls at Matthiessen State Park or the sandstone bluffs on the Vermilion River near Streator where famous explorers and Indian Tribes once roamed, the area offers a host of outdoor activities. Discover the newly established Illinois River Road National Scenic Byway that winds its way through many communities of LaSalle County. Whether you enjoy hiking, picnicking, fishing, boating, horseback riding, canoeing, camping, or simply enjoying the scenery - LaSalle County has it all.
